Blindsight
A state where an individual reacts to things they see without being aware of them, usually because of harm to the primary visual cortex.
Change Blindness
A psychological phenomenon where a person does not notice some significant change in the visual field when the change occurs outside of the person's visual focal point.
Parallel Processing
The ability of the brain to process many aspects of a problem or scene at the same time, which plays an essential role in tasks such as visual perception.
